So... a little update here. Furthering on my 'chasing ghosts' investigation into this very minimal 'hum' I had through my speakers, I replaced every tube with the NOS backups that I had purchased. I realized it made more sense (to me) to start with a fresh set of tubes all around, rather than using the 'remainder' of the tubes that were shipped with the amp... Since I have no idea how much 'life' is left on those tubes, why not keep those as backups and run with the new tubes instead? I liked this idea, and also hoped it would solve the 'hum' I was hearing.
To recap, the hum was stronger in the right channel, and only appeared after maybe an hour after the amp was on, strongly indicating a heat-related phenomenon. Changing the tubes greatly helped! It reduced the hum by about 50%, but it still remained... Since I was 'on the job', so to speak, I decided to swap my left and right channel tubes to see if the hum would follow. I figured this would tell me if it's caused by the tubes, or something in the amp circuit. Well... after the L/R channel swap, the hum was nearly completely gone, and all that remained was a basically equal amount of very very very low level hum on each channel... Which, again, was only audible with my ear basically pressed up next to the driver. From everything I've read on the subject, all SET amps hum to some degree, by the nature of their circuit (unlike push-pull amps)... and it's just a matter of degree of 'how much' hum there is -- ranging from barely audible with ear-to-speaker, to 'this is annoying even when music is playing'. Fortunately, I seem to be waaaay on the 'quiet' end of this scale, so I'd venture to guess that the amp is working perfectly as intended.
I'm totally baffled why the tube swaps would yield such a seemingly random result though... Logically you would think that either the slight hum that was originally in the right channel would either remain there, or be equally swapped to the left channel... but for it to disappear --?? What voodoo is this? One thought I had, based on reading another thread, is that it could actually be caused by the fit between a particular tube and socket... These old tubes commonly have corrosion built up on the pins, and the only thing I did before inserting them was to carefully clean them with isopropyl alcohol... So, maybe I'm hearing the slight effects of some resistance between the tube pin and the socket sleeve... Shrug, I have no idea. Does this sound plausible, or is there a more likely explanation?
